Plyometrics, more than jumping onto a box Part 1


Part I will discuss the basic biomechanics of what goes on during plyometrics.

Reactivity, elasticity, and sometimes referred to as buoyancy, plays a very important role in all sports and running. The ability to change direction, sprint, and jump rely heavily on the body’s ability to produce force, relax, and repeat force production.

Taking a look at common practice through visiting professionals, reading material, and learning from other great coaches, a very common variation in each persons approach to development is how they incorporate plyometrics. I hear a common phrase; “most athletes aren’t strong enough so I don’t do them.” Which I will expand upon more later. Some think it is all about how many inches you can jump onto a box. Opposite of that some think it is all about jumping off the tallest box you can. I will also explain why the common test for explosive power (vertical jump) doesn’t quiet tell the whole story.

What Happens When You Jump?
First and for most lets take a look at the biomechanics that come into play when performing a jump in relationship to the stretch shortening cycle (SSC). Taking a look at Hill’s model, two of the three components make a serious contribution. The contractile element (CE) composed of muscle fibers, and the series elastic component (SEC) mainly being the tendon. When performing a jump, these components are stretched, allowing them to store energy, and this energy is released upon rapid contraction. The tendon has the greatest capacity to store energy with little stretch do to it being a rigid structure. Unlike the muscle, which is supple, can stretch much further without storing the same amounts of energy. This would promote the concept that a greater the ability to stretch the tendon during a SSC, the more energy that can be released. This stretch in the tendon would be optimal if the muscle does not stretch. Basically, the more eccentrically a muscle acts within a SSC the less stretch you get out of the tendon.

Testing Week: Hang Clean


In preparing for sports and while putting athletes through a program it is important to always be evaluating them for improvements in abilities such as strength, posture, flexibility and so forth. This week marks about six weeks since our last strength evaluation in which we use 3 exercises as our "indicators" for improvement in strength along with a few skill test to determine our progress over a certain period of time.

Test 1 of 3
Hang Clean

Why

1. Ground Based Movement: The ability for an athlete to produce force against the ground will determine the athletes ability to do jump, run, and accelerate. Also, athletes do everything with there feet on the ground, standing up, and getting from A to B as fast as possible.

2. Multi Joint: The primary goal for us while performing an explosive movement is to achieve triple extension. This would be the full extension of the ankle, hips, and knees in the most explosive manner possible. This is important because triple extension happens when running, jumping, and most anytime you try to produce great amounts of force during competition.

3. Athletic Position: It is important to train an athlete in similar positions that he will play. Due to the fact that most all the positions will assume the athletic position through the duration of a game, it would indicate the importance to develop strength/explosiveness from this position. So far the testing has gone great. We have had an average increase of ~25 pounds with the best being a 50 pound jump from 320 to 370 in just 6 weeks form the last testing. It is important not to just jump into the hang clean with out progressing however. I wrote a while back about our progression in the clean and it has paid off. I used a bottom up approach, teaching the basic concepts of triple extension through jumping exercises, and loaded jump shrugs. They gradually progressed into high pulls and cleans down the road. We emphasized the hip extension portion a lot by programming basic variations of some corrective stretches paired with the explosive lift to coordinate that pattern.

There are many people who may choose to do these from the floor or simply not at all. Why I chose to do them...Results. Our verticals continue to go up, 40's are all going down so I feel like the force developed from the clean has paid off.
